/programs/fs/Eolite/trunk/Eolite.c-- |
---|
1,4 → 1,4 |
//Leency & Veliant -=- KolibriOS Team -=- 2011 |
//Leency & Veliant -=- KolibriOS Team -=- 2012 |
//GNU GPL licence. |
//íåìíîãî êðèâàÿ ïðîêðóòêà |
16,7 → 16,7 |
#define ONLY_OPEN 2 |
//ïåðåìåííûå |
#define title "Eolite File Manager v0.99.8" |
#define title "Eolite File Manager v0.99.9" |
#define videlenie 0x94AECE //0xFEA4B7,0x8BCDFF,0xB8C9B8}; //öâåò âûäåëåííîãî ýëåìåíòà èç ñïèñêà ôàéëîâ |
byte toolbar_buttons_x[6]={9,46,85,134,167,203}; |
// |
368,7 → 368,7 |
{ |
DefineAndDrawWindow(98,90,582,482,0x73,0x10E4DFE1,0,0,title); |
Form.GetInfo(#Form, SelfInfo); |
IF (Form.height==GetSkinWidth()+3) return; //íè÷åãî íå äåëàòü åñëè îêíî ñõëîïíóòî â çàãîëîâîê |
IF (Form.status_window==4) return; //íè÷åãî íå äåëàòü åñëè îêíî ñõëîïíóòî â çàãîëîâîê |
IF (Form.height<280) MoveSize(OLD,OLD,OLD,280); |
IF (Form.width<480) MoveSize(OLD,OLD,480,OLD); |
//toolbar buttons |
/programs/fs/Eolite/trunk/compile.bat |
---|
1,4 → 1,4 |
@..\C--\c-- Eolite.c |
@..\C--\c-- Eolite.c-- |
del Eolite |
rename Eolite.com Eolite |
@..\C--\kpack Eolite |
/programs/fs/Eolite/trunk/include/about_dialog.h-- |
---|
1,4 → 1,4 |
//Leency - 2011 |
//Leency - 2012 |
#include "imgs\logo.txt" |
37,11 → 37,11 |
DefineAndDrawWindow(500,200,181,256,0x34,0x10EFEBEF,0,0,"About Eolite"); |
DrawBar(0,0,172,50,0x8494C4); //ãîëóáîå ñçàäè |
PutPaletteImage(#logo,85,85,43,7,#logo_pal); |
WriteText(33,100,0x80,0xBF40BF,"Eolite v0.99.8 RC3",0); |
WriteText(33,100,0x80,0xBF40BF,"Eolite v0.99.9 RC3",0); |
WriteText(55,120,0x80,0,"Developers:",0); |
WriteText(39,130,0x80,0,"Leency & Veliant",0); |
WriteText(30,140,0x80,0,"Diamond, Lrz, Nable",0); |
WriteText(55,150,0x80,0," 2008-2011 ",0); |
WriteText(55,150,0x80,0," 2008-2012 ",0); |
WriteText(12,170,0x80,0,"Visit",0); |
DrawLink(48,170,23, "kolibri-os.narod.ru"); //ññûëêa |
DrawFlatButton(85,190,70,22,0,0xE4DFE1, "Close"); |
/programs/fs/Eolite/trunk/include/ini.h-- |
---|
1,5 → 1,5 |
//INI parser in C--, GPL licence. |
//Leency - 2011 |
//Leency - 2012 |
#define COMMENT 0 |
#define SECTION 1 |
/programs/fs/Eolite/trunk/include/some_code.h-- |
---|
1,4 → 1,4 |
//Leency - 2011 |
//Leency - 2012 |
#define add_new_path 1 |
#define go_back 2 |
/programs/fs/Eolite/trunk/include/sorting.h-- |
---|
1,4 → 1,4 |
//Áûñòðàÿ ñîðòèðîâêà. Leency 2008. GPL license. |
//Áûñòðàÿ ñîðòèðîâêà. Leency 2008. |
void Sort_by_Size(int a, b) // äëÿ ïåðâîãî âûçîâà: a = 0, b = <ýëåìåíòîâ â ìàññèâå> - 1 |
{ |
/programs/fs/Eolite/trunk/lib/file_system.h-- |
---|
1,4 → 1,4 |
//CODED by Veliant, Leency. GNU GPL licence. |
//CODED by Veliant, Leency 2008-2012. GNU GPL licence. |
struct f70{ |
dword func; |
/programs/fs/Eolite/trunk/lib/kolibri.h-- |
---|
1,4 → 1,4 |
//CODED by Veliant, Leency. GNU GPL licence. |
//CODED by Veliant, Leency 2008-2012. GNU GPL licence. |
#startaddress 0 |
#code32 TRUE |